WebOlder adults are prone to skin breakdown due to the loss of lean body mass, thinning of the epidermis, decreased elasticity of the skin, decreased oil production, decreased venous and arterial blood flow, and decreased pain sensation. Factors Affecting Skin Integrity: Chronic Medical Conditions WebLoss of MAGP-1 around the hair follicle/pore areas was also observed, suggesting a possible correlation between MAGP-1 loss and enlarged pores in aged skin. ... Such changes may contribute to age-related loss of dermal integrity and perifollicular structural support, which may lead to skin fragility, sagging, and enlarged pores.

This new formulation is based … mediterranean latin love affairWeb6 de dez. de 2024 · Transepidermal water loss (TEWL) is widely used to assess and quantify skin insensible water loss to assess skin’s barrier function integrity. Low TEWL values are normally indicative of intact skin and a healthy functional barrier, whereas an increased TEWL reveals a disturbed or disrupted skin barrier.
